Subject: Key rotation — FuelTrace report service

Welcome, new folks. Quick heads-up: the key for FuelTrace, the internal service that generates the weekly fleet fuel-usage report, rotated this morning. Old key is dead as of now. Update your local env config and the report cron's secrets file, then trigger a test run to confirm the report builds. Ping on-call if the run fails twice. The new FuelTrace key is below.

gateway credential: vxb4-QTMv

## LiftSim — Environment Variables

LiftSim, the elevator-dispatch simulator maintained by the Verralto platform group, reads all runtime configuration from `conf/liftsim.env`. Support staff should verify `LS_BUILDING_PROFILE` points at a valid profile JSON and that `LS_TICK_MS` stays between 50 and 500, as values outside that range distort dispatch latency reports. Scenario uploads to the results archive are authenticated per session, so the archive credential must be present. Add the following line beneath this paragraph:

env line for fafof-fahag: LEDGER_TOKEN5=f8790

Subject: Cut-over done — Marrowgate health checks

Cut-over finished last night. The Marrowgate API pool now sits behind the new Lintbarrow load balancer. Old TCP checks replaced with HTTP checks against the readiness endpoint; draining respects in-flight requests up to the timeout. Two nodes flapped during the switch — root cause was the old check interval still cached on one LB node, now purged. Please review the diff against what's actually deployed. For reference, the live health-check configuration on the new balancer is below.

settings of tagag-fajeg:
[quenion]
host = quenion.ordingrid.corp
user = quenion_svc
database = quenion_prod